Build agents in the Varnholt pool sync against the internal Tessera time service. Skew above 400ms can invalidate signed build attestations and timestamped audit logs, so it is treated as a security-relevant incident, not a mere ops nuisance. Check the agent's drift metric in the Ostrel dashboard before escalating, and capture the NTP trace output for the review record. For skew incidents affecting attestation integrity, the Platform Integrity rotation owns triage and should be contacted directly.

pager mailbox: druwyn@norvaio.corp

## Releases — Chirpline Log Sampler

Quick heads-up for whoever's cutting the release: Chirpline is extremely chatty, so the sampler config ships inside the release bundle itself (default 1:500 for info, 1:1 for errors). Don't hand-edit sampling rates post-deploy — bump the config and cut a patch release instead, or the fleet drifts. Every bundle gets signed before the uploader will accept it, and the fleet refuses unsigned configs outright. The key used to sign release bundles appears below.

rollout seal: bky19_M1Zvn1YQwEBTy4XxP3H

2024-11-R3 — Canary gating key rotation. The Pellwick canary controller now refuses promotion manifests signed with the retired Q3 key. Gating rules are unchanged: 5% traffic for 30 minutes, error budget under 0.2%, then auto-promote. Reviewers should confirm that any open PRs touching the gate config re-sign their manifests before merge, or the controller will hard-fail the promotion. The replacement signing key, effective immediately for all canary promotions, is listed below.

deploy key for faweg-kahop: bky19_24TiFikVm4H3cNg1EgJ